This company file is on another computer, and QuickBooks needs some help connecting. ![]() When a workstation fails to access a company file placed on another computer, it results in H202 QuickBooks error. All other computers connected to the network (that don’t host the QBW files) are called workstations. On a multi-user network, QuickBooks company files (QBW) are stored on a server computer. Inability to communicate with the server computer will prevent you from accessing the QuickBooks company file. This error usually means that multi-user connection to your server computer, used for storing QuickBooks company files (QBW), is blocked. When switching QuickBooks to multi-user mode, users often report receiving error code H202 in QuickBooks.
